PV STRONG: A Benefit for the Vallarta Gay+ Community Center Date: Sunday, April 13 – 7:30 pm (Cocktails 6:30 pm)

Prepare to immerse yourself in an evening of unparalleled entertainment at PV STRONG – A Benefit for the Vallarta Gay+ Community Center! This spectacular event, slated to take place on April 13th at 7:30 pm (with cocktails commencing at 6:30 pm), promises an electrifying celebration in support of the Vallarta Gay+ Community Center.

Embrace the vibrancy of the LGBTQ+ community as Act2PV hosts a night filled with love, laughter, and dazzling performances, all in honor of a noble cause. Spearheaded by a formidable ensemble of LGBTQ+ advocates, PV STRONG is dedicated to fostering inclusivity and promoting access to vital health services within the community. With a steadfast commitment to STI prevention and detection, alongside the provision of essential resources, the Vallarta Gay+ Community Center serves as a beacon of support and empowerment for individuals from all walks of life.
